我正在设置三重启动硬盘,并打算使用第 4 个分区在操作系统之间共享文件。我想知道在每个操作系统分区上留出足够的空间来存储文件是否有意义,或者我是否只需将共享分区弄大并将所有内容放在该分区上?访问共享分区上的文件与访问本机文件的速度之间是否存在差异?将文件放在本机/共享分区上还有其他好处/缺点吗?
编辑:
所涉及的操作系统是 Windows 7、Ubuntu 12.04 和 OS X 10.7.4。
答案1
诀窍是找到一种文件系统类型,它将得到您想要运行的所有不同操作系统的良好支持。选择很少:Linux 很好地支持 ext2/ext3,但 MacOS X 仅在用户空间中支持它们(性能较差),而 MS Windows 可能根本不支持它们。NTFS 得到了 MS Windows 的良好支持,但尽管 ntfs-3g 可以在 Linux 或 MacOS X(仅在用户空间)下安装它,但它是一种专有的未记录文件系统,因此没有任何保证。HFS+ 无疑是在仅限 MacOS 的环境中使用的最佳文件系统,但肯定也不是一个可行的选择。
您只剩下一个糟糕的最低标准:FAT。而且您并不想将所有重要文件都放在 FAT 文件系统上。
因此,您最好在每个操作系统中使用适合该操作系统的大型文件系统,并在单独的分区中使用小型共享 FAT 文件系统。